Extending the Gaia methodology for the design and development of agent-based Software systems

被引:0
|
作者
Huang, Wei [1 ]
El-Darzi, Elia [1 ]
Jin, Li [1 ]
机构
[1] Univ Westminster, Sch Comp Sci, Watford Rd, London HA1 3TP, England
关键词
D O I
暂无
中图分类号
TP [自动化技术、计算机技术];
学科分类号
0812 ;
摘要
Over the past decade, agent-based computing has emerged as a new and popular paradigm for design, implementation and analysis of distributed information systems. In this paper, the participant researchers in Health Care Computing Group at University of Westminster concentrate on the agent-oriented methodology for the analysis and design of agent-based systems and identify how methodology can support both the levels of "agent structure" and of "agent society" in the agent-oriented software design and development process. The research reported here takes one leading agent-oriented methodology-Gaia, and then extended it by the creation of innovative design tools which aimed at better supporting application to real-world domains. In discussion section, agent-oriented methodology and AUML approaches are compared and evaluated in great detail; the strengths and weaknesses of the current agent-oriented methodology are explored and discussed; the importance of effectively using methodology to improve agents and their productivity potential also is emphasized. Finally, we draw conclusions from the work presented and the experience gained in this research and look into the future possible improvements on agent-oriented software engineering in the agent technology research field.
引用
收藏
页码:159 / +
页数:2
相关论文
共 50 条
  • [1] UML extending methodology for agents and agent-based systems
    Pivk, Aleksander
    Krisper, Marjan
    [J]. Elektrotehniski Vestnik/Electrotechnical Review, 2003, 70 (03): : 123 - 128
  • [2] Extending Gaia with agent design and iterative development
    Gonzalez-Palacios, Jorge
    Luck, Michael
    [J]. AGENT-ORIENTED SOFTWARE ENGINEERING VIII, 2008, 4951 : 16 - +
  • [3] Agent-based methodology for developing mechatronic systems software
    Kizauskiene, L.
    Kazanavicius, E.
    Gaidys, R.
    [J]. MECHANIKA, 2011, (05): : 551 - 556
  • [4] Applying Constructionist Design Methodology to Agent-Based Simulation Systems
    Thorisson, Kristinn R.
    Saemundsson, Rognvaldur J.
    Jonsdottir, Gudny R.
    Reynisson, Brynjar
    Pedica, Claudio
    Thrainsson, Pall Runar
    Skowronski, Palmi
    [J]. AGENT AND MULTI-AGENT SYSTEMS: TECHNOLOGIES AND APPLICATIONS, PROCEEDINGS, 2009, 5559 : 203 - +
  • [5] A methodology for the protocol-centered design of agent-based systems
    Bhatt, PCP
    Mueller, W
    [J]. IECON 2000: 26TH ANNUAL CONFERENCE OF THE IEEE INDUSTRIAL ELECTRONICS SOCIETY, VOLS 1-4: 21ST CENTURY TECHNOLOGIES AND INDUSTRIAL OPPORTUNITIES, 2000, : 1304 - 1309
  • [6] A formal development and validation methodology applied to agent-based systems
    Serugendo, GDM
    [J]. INFRASTRUCTURE FOR AGENTS, MULTI-AGENT SYSTEMS, AND SCALABLE MULTI-AGENT SYSTEMS, 2001, 1887 : 214 - 225
  • [7] A framework for agent-based software development
    Far, BH
    [J]. EURASIA-ICT 2002: INFORMATION AND COMMUNICATION TECHNOLOGY, PROCEEDINGS, 2002, 2510 : 990 - 997
  • [8] Metrics for agent-based software development
    Far, BH
    Wanyama, T
    [J]. CCECE 2003: CANADIAN CONFERENCE ON ELECTRICAL AND COMPUTER ENGINEERING, VOLS 1-3, PROCEEDINGS: TOWARD A CARING AND HUMANE TECHNOLOGY, 2003, : 1297 - 1300
  • [9] An agent-based software development method for developing an agent-based multimedia system
    Lee, CHL
    Liu, A
    Chen, KY
    [J]. IEEE FIFTH INTERNATIOANL SYMPOSIUM ON MULTIMEDIA SOFTWARE ENGINEERING, PROCEEDINGS, 2003, : 132 - 139
  • [10] An agent-based approach for crowdsourcing software design
    Li, Hui
    Hao, Li-Ying
    Ge, Xin
    Gao, Jian
    Guo, Shikai
    [J]. PROCEEDINGS OF THE 28TH CHINESE CONTROL AND DECISION CONFERENCE (2016 CCDC), 2016, : 4497 - 4501